Early Life and Journey to Cricket Stardom

Gill’s passion for cricket ignited at a tender age, and he started honing his skills in hometown. His dedication and talent did not go unnoticed and he soon caught the attention of cricket coaches and selectors. Gill’s exceptional performances in junior-level tournaments earned  a spot in the Punjab Under-16 team where he made an immediate impact with batting skills.

Gill’s meteoric rise continued as he progressed through ranks, representing India in various age-group tournaments. His outstanding performances in 2018 ICC Under-19 World Cup played pivotal role in India’s victorious campaign. Gill was leading run-scorer of tournament, scored an impressive 372 runs at average of 124.00. His ability to tackle both pace and spin with ease along with remarkable technique, caught the attention of cricket enthusiasts worldwide.

Shubman Gill Stats

Despite being relatively new to international cricket, Gill has already engraved name in the record books. As of 2023, he has scored 1816 runs in 35 ODI matches at an average of 64.41. His average of 64.41 reflects his consistent performances at the highest level in such a short international career. In Test match he has scored 966 runs in 18 matches and in T20 Internationals he has scored 304 runs in 11 matches at an average of 30.40 which also include a century.

International Career

ODI

Gill’s consistent performances at domestic level garnered a spot in the Indian national team. He made international debut in January 2019 during a One Day International (ODI) against New Zealand. Since then Gill has been a regular fixture in Indian squad showcasing batting skills and contributing significantly to team’s success.

T20I

Shubman Gill started his T20 international career in January 2023, when he played against Sri Lanka at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ai. He has also scored highest individual score by an Indian when he smashed 126 not out against New Zealand in Ahmedabad in February 2023.

TEST

Subhaman Gill made Test debut for India in December 2020 against Australia which had helped India to a comeback and win the second match of series.

His memorable innings of 91 runs against Australia  at Gabba in 2020-21 Border-Gavaskar Trophy earned him praise for his composure and maturity. Gill displayed impeccable technique, which allowed him to excel against a formidable Australian bowling attack. His performances played a crucial role in India’s historic series victory.

Gill had scored first century of his Test career against Bangladesh in December 2022. Till he has scored two centuries in Test career.

Shubman Gill Records

Here are some of his achievements:

  • He has 2nd highest career batting average in One Day Internationals i.e. 64.40.
  • He is the second fastest batsman to score 1000 runs in ODI in just 19 innings.
  • Youngest player in the ODI history to score a double hundred that was 208 runs against New Zealand.
  • He has scored highest individual score i.e. 126 runs by any Indian in T20 surpassing Virat Kohli.
